Telephone
To answer a call
Tip: To adjust the volume
of the speaker during an
active call, use the Arrows
key: pressing > increases the
volume, pressing <
decreases the volume.
Figure 18
Tip: The callers name
appears in the note if the
telephone number is sent
with the call, and if the
callers number is listed in
your Contacts directory.
1 When you receive a call and the communicator cover is open, a note about the
incoming call appears. To answer the call, press Answer or close the device
cover and answer the call via the cover phone.
2 If you do not want to take the call, press Reject. To mute the ringing tone, press
Mute tone.
Note: You cannot have two active calls at the same time unless you are in a
conference call. A current call is automatically put on hold when you
answer a new incoming call. For information about conference calls, see
To make conference calls on page 74.
To call and create a voice mailbox
Voice mailboxes work just like an answering machine. You can use them to store
incoming messages of missed calls. Many network operators provide a voice
mailbox service with the SIM card. If your SIM voice mailbox does not have a
number, you can type it yourself. Note that you are still required to contact your
network operator for a phone number to use with this voice mailbox.
